Distance Learning Population
Franklin University offers the distance learning opportunities (online degree program and/or courses) for both undergraduate and graduate programs. 6,358 students (93.29% of total students) are enrolled online exclusively and 100 students (1.47% of total students) are enrolled some online courses.
